Q3 Planning Note — Possible Acquisition

Welcome aboard! One item to flag early: we've been circling Bramblewick Systems for a few months now. Their Lattice scheduling tool would plug a real gap in our Ovida suite, and their Kestrel Falls team is strong. Diligence kicks off next month if the board nods. For your eyes only, here's where we actually stand.

management briefing: Project Ulavan slips by two quarters because of the staffing delay.

CI note: if the lintgate job fails with "baseline drift detected," someone changed code covered by the static-analysis baseline file (quietus-baseline.json) without regenerating it. Fix: run `quietus scan --rebaseline` locally, commit the updated file, and re-push. Do not hand-edit the baseline; the checksum will mismatch and the job fails again. When escalating to the tooling team, include the trace token printed below.

trace token, kahog-tajeg: htk6_97d963

// REINDEX_BATCH_CAP limits docs per shard pass in the Tallowfield
// nightly search reindex. Raising it starves the ingest queue;
// lowering it overruns the maintenance window. 5000 is the tested
// sweet spot. Change only with a soak run. Verified against the
// build noted below.

session token of bawif-hahog = htk6_ac5981

Internal Memo — FY Headcount Plan

To all sales leads: the draft headcount plan for next year allows for twelve additional field roles, weighted toward the Arkenvale and Sutton Reach territories. Backfills will be approved case by case, and any role vacant beyond ninety days reverts to the central pool. Please review your territory projections carefully and submit justifications by month-end. One sensitive planning item accompanies this memo and follows immediately below.

board note of tawig-bajof: The renewal with Ralixix Holdings closes at $10 million a year, 20 percent above the last contract. Project Druix slips by two quarters because of the tooling delay.

## Deep-link routing: release checks

Before promoting a Wrenpath mobile build, verify deep-link routing against the staging resolver. Broken links fall back to the home screen silently, so regressions are easy to miss. Run the link matrix test for both cold-start and warm-start paths, and confirm universal links resolve on both platforms. The full routing table and the verification script are maintained on the internal routing page.

operations page: https://jenkins.zemvarcloud.local/job/merge_requests/repo/build/73930b4b30f0a8ed